How to choose a laser thickness gauge?

How to choose a laser thickness gauge?

Laser thickness gauge is generally composed of two laser displacement sensors that shoot up and down. The two sensors measure the position of the upper and lower surfaces of the measured object respectively, and calculate the thickness of the measured object. The advantage of a laser thickness gauge is that it uses non-contact measurement, which is more accurate than a contact thickness gauge and will not lose accuracy due to wear. Compared to ultrasonic thickness gauges, the accuracy is higher. Compared to X-ray thickness gauges, there is no radiation contamination.

Application scope of laser thickness gauge: it can be widely used for real-time online measurement of contour, thickness, width, diameter, material level and vibration of various transparent and non transparent plates, sheets, foam plates, hollow plates, waterproof rolls, films, patches, metal plates and other products in rubber, steel, automobile, machinery, light industry and other industries.

How to choose a laser thickness gauge? You can refer to the following points:

1. Tell the manufacturer various information about the measured product, such as product thickness, vibration, movement speed, etc., in order to determine which thickness gauge is needed.

2. What is the thickness range of the tested product and what is the smaller thickness? A thickness gauge with a suitable range is generally recommended based on these two outer diameter values.

3. What is the required accuracy for the thickness of the measured object? The measurement accuracy of laser thickness gauges can generally be better than 0.01mm, with an accuracy of 0.004mm. A suitable one can be selected based on the measurement range and accuracy.
